Which one of the following statements regarding the memorandum of incorporation (MOI)
is TRUE in terms of the Companies Act?
a.
Once a company’s memorandum of incorporation (MOI) has been lodged with the CIPC it
may not be altered.
b.
Shares with par value may only be authorised and issued in a newly incorporated company,
if allowed by the memorandum of incorporation (MOI).
c.
A company’s memorandum of incorporation (MOI) may not permit a lower percentage of
voting rights to approve any special resolutions.
d.
The board may, unless prohibited by the memorandum of incorporation (MOI), make
changes to the number of authorised shares of a company.
